In Western artwork music, the most typical kinds of prepared notation are scores, which incorporate every one of live the music areas of an ensemble piece, and areas, which are the music notation for the person performers or singers. In preferred music, jazz, and blues, the typical musical notation would be the direct sheet, which notates the melody, chords, lyrics (if it is a vocal piece), and framework on the music. Faux publications may also be used in jazz; They might encompass guide sheets or just chord charts, which allow rhythm area customers to improvise an accompaniment part to jazz tracks.

The melody to the standard song "Pop Goes the Weasel" playⓘ A melody, also called a "tune", can be a number of pitches (notes) sounding in succession (one after the other), frequently in the soaring and falling sample. The notes of the melody are typically developed making use of pitch devices which include scales or modes. Melodies also frequently contain notes within the chords Employed in the music. The melodies in basic folks music and common music may well use only the notes of a single scale, the dimensions associated with the tonic Observe or critical of a supplied song. For instance, a folks music in The crucial element of C (also known as C big) can have a melody that uses only the notes in the C big scale (the individual notes C, D, E, F, G, A, B, and C; these are definitely the "white notes" with a piano keyboard.
